The distance from Naples to Sicily (Island) is approximately 224 miles (362 km).
The average frequency per day from Naples to Sicily (Island) is:
  • Around 52 flights per day.
  • Around 6 buses per day.
  • Around 3 ferries per day.
  • Around 2 trains per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Naples and Sicily (Island) as scheduled services by train, bus, flight, and ferry can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Naples to Sicily (Island):
  • Flights mostly depart from Naples International Airport and arrive in Catania Fontanarossa Airport.
  • Trains mostly depart from Naples Centrale and arrive in Villarosa station.
  • Buses mostly depart from Napoli, Napoli Centrale and arrive in Enna, Via Leonardo da Vinci (Bassa).
  • Ferries mostly depart from Port of Naples and arrive in Port of Palermo.
